  2. Which of the following statements accurately describes an argument of the Anti-Federalists?
    The Constitution lacked a Bill of Rights

  4. In his interpretation of the Constitutional Convention, the historian Charles Beard focused on the importance of
    economic interests of a wealthy elite
  5. In 1788, the Federalists promised to add a bill of rights to the Constitution in order to
    persuade state conventions to ratify the Constitution

  8. The Virginia and Kentucky Resolutions presented the argument that
    states could nullify acts of Congress
  9. The decline in support for the Federalist party can be traced most directly to its handling of the issue of
    the Alien and Sedition acts
